This PR adds support for custom operation-level examples for GraphQL queries and mutations in metadata files. Previously, SpectaQL would ignore custom examples provided in metadata and generate auto-examples with placeholder values instead.
Fixes #1048
Key Changes
Supported Formats
The implementation prioritizes custom examples when available, and falls back to auto-generation when not provided, maintaining backward compatibility.
